Relocating to St. Helena

St. Helena continues to attract visitors and new homebuyers with its status as a small town agricultural center, a provider of fine wines and fine food, and its location within easy reach of sea, mountains and San Francisco.


Recent sales of agricultural land in Napa County ranged in price valley-wide from $45,000 to $300,000 per acre. In the heart of the valley, i.e. Oakville, Rutherford, St. Helena, and Howell Mountain, recent sale prices ranged from $150,000 to $300,000 per acre. Source: Wine Industry Symposium September 2007, Tony Correia of Correia-Xavier.


Like the rest of the United States, valley-wide home sales in 2007 were generally down. Hardest hit were St. Helena and American Canyon with total number of residential sales down about 45% from the prior year.


Despite slower sales in 2007, median home prices actually increased slightly in St. Helena.

Town Residential Sales* Median Sale Price*
St Helena 73 $1,105,000
Calistoga 50 $797,500
Yountville 25 $830,000
Napa 737 $615,000
American Canyon 85 $590,000
 *estimates based on sales through 10/07
